将ELF拆分为asm并再次组装到ELF

时间:2014-05-15 15:20:21

标签: linux reverse-engineering elf

假设我在x86或x86_64上运行一个盒子,并且在可执行文件和可链接格式(ELF)中有一个可执行文件/库。

是否可能?
  1. 从ELF生成汇编程序列表,然后
  2. 再次将它组装回ELF?
  3. 如果是,

    • 有没有工具可以做到这一点(第一步)?
    • 是否可以生成与原始ELF按位相同的ELF?如果没有,那么完美的情况会有多接近?

0 个答案:

没有答案